What is an Automotive Finance Calculator?

An Automotive Finance Calculator is a financial tool used to estimate the cost of financing a vehicle. It calculates monthly payments based on key factors such as loan amount, interest rate, down payment, and repayment period.

This calculator is widely used by car buyers, financial advisors, and dealerships because it provides a transparent view of the total cost of ownership before signing any loan agreement.

How the Calculation Works

The Automotive Finance Calculator uses a standard amortization formula. This formula spreads the loan evenly across the selected term, ensuring consistent monthly payments.

Each monthly payment includes:

  • A portion that reduces the principal loan amount
  • A portion that covers interest charges

At the beginning of the loan, interest makes up a larger portion of the payment. As time progresses, more of the payment is applied to the principal.

Practical Example

Let’s consider a real-world scenario:

  • Vehicle Price: $45,000
  • Down Payment: $10,000
  • Loan Amount: $35,000
  • Interest Rate: 6.5%
  • Loan Term: 60 months

Estimated Results:

  • Monthly Payment: ~$684
  • Total Interest Paid: ~$5,640
  • Total Loan Cost: ~$40,640

This example shows how financing affects the total cost beyond the original vehicle price.

Important Financial Insights

  • A larger down payment reduces monthly payments and total interest
  • A lower interest rate significantly reduces total loan cost
  • A shorter loan term saves money but increases monthly payments
  • Always focus on total repayment, not just monthly affordability

Tips for Better Automotive Financing

  • Maintain a strong credit score before applying
  • Compare multiple lenders before choosing one
  • Avoid unnecessarily long loan terms
  • Consider insurance, maintenance, and fuel costs in your budget

Common Mistakes to Avoid

  • Focusing only on monthly payments
  • Ignoring total interest cost
  • Not comparing financing offers
  • Overestimating affordability based on income
